What Defines Coastal Traditional House Plans?

Coastal traditional house plans combine classic architectural character with construction features suited for coastal environments.
These homes are thoughtfully designed to handle wind, salt air, and elevated building requirements—while maintaining timeless curb appeal and comfortable interiors.

Common characteristics include:

  • Balanced, open floor plans with abundant natural light
  • Welcoming front and rear porches designed for outdoor living
  • Large, well-proportioned windows for coastal views and ventilation
  • Raised or elevated foundations for flood and wind resilience
  • Durable exterior materials such as fiber cement siding, stucco, and impact-rated windows

These elements make coastal traditional house plans ideal for waterfront lots, barrier islands, and inland homes seeking classic coastal style with long-term durability.

Important Considerations When Building Near the Coast

When building a coastal traditional home, thoughtful planning is essential. Be sure to:

  • Coordinate with local building departments for wind and flood requirements
  • Select materials rated for salt-air and humidity exposure
  • Plan drainage and landscaping for coastal conditions
  • Incorporate elevated foundations and impact-resistant glazing
